Several exhibitions and conferences covering Free Software and GNU/Linux
will take place this month. The Debian project has been offered to
participarte in three of them. The events take place in Brazil, Mexico
and Germany.
May 2nd - 4th: Third International Forum on Free Software
(Porto Alegre, Rio Grande do Sul, Brazil)
http://www.debian.org/events/2002/0502-softwarelivre
Almost all brazilian Debian developers will meet at this
event and will promote Debian through a course and
a talk.
May 16th - 19th: Días de Software Libre (Guadalajara, Jalisco, Mexico)
http://www.debian.org/events/2002/0516-dsl
People from the Free Software Foundation, Ximian, the
Debian project and others will meet at this event and
promote Free Software. Debian will be represented
with an introductory speech and a talk that covers
package formats with a special focus on the Debian
package format.
May 25th - 26th: 3rd Magdeburger Linuxtag (Magdeburg, Germany)
http://www.debian.org/events/2002/0525-linuxtag-magdeburg
German developers and users of GNU/Linux will attend
this exhibition and conference. The Debian project
will demonstrate the Woody release at the booth.
Andreas Tille will also give a talk about the Debian
Med subproject.
